In contextMatthew 21:2

saying to them Go into the village the opposite of you and immediately you will find donkey tied and colt with her having untied bring to me

About this coordinate

Matthew 21:2:16 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 16 of Matthew 21:2, so the Greek word πῶλον (pôlon)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Matt.21.2.W16, which extends further down to each syllable (Matt.21.2.W16.S1) and character.
